mlaccetti/JavaPNS

View on GitHub
Branch: develop(View all)
NameLines of codeMaintainabilityTest coverage
.codeclimate.yml
.editorconfig
.gitignore
.travis.yml
LICENSE
README.md
pom.xml
src/main/java/javapns/Push.java151
C
7 hrs
src/main/java/javapns/communication/AppleServer.java11
A
0 mins
src/main/java/javapns/communication/AppleServerBasicImpl.java37
A
0 mins
src/main/java/javapns/communication/ConnectionToAppleServer.java138
A
3 hrs
src/main/java/javapns/communication/KeystoreManager.java171
B
6 hrs
src/main/java/javapns/communication/ProxyManager.java57
A
3 hrs
src/main/java/javapns/communication/ServerTrustingTrustManager.java14
A
0 mins
src/main/java/javapns/communication/WrappedKeystore.java17
A
0 mins
src/main/java/javapns/communication/exceptions/CommunicationException.java7
A
0 mins
src/main/java/javapns/communication/exceptions/InvalidCertificateChainException.java10
A
0 mins
src/main/java/javapns/communication/exceptions/InvalidKeystoreFormatException.java10
A
0 mins
src/main/java/javapns/communication/exceptions/InvalidKeystorePasswordException.java10
A
0 mins
src/main/java/javapns/communication/exceptions/InvalidKeystoreReferenceException.java13
A
0 mins
src/main/java/javapns/communication/exceptions/KeystoreException.java10
A
0 mins
src/main/java/javapns/communication/exceptions/package.html
src/main/java/javapns/communication/package.html
src/main/java/javapns/devices/Device.java10
A
0 mins
src/main/java/javapns/devices/DeviceFactory.java11
A
0 mins
src/main/java/javapns/devices/Devices.java71
B
5 hrs
src/main/java/javapns/devices/exceptions/DuplicateDeviceException.java14
A
45 mins
src/main/java/javapns/devices/exceptions/InvalidDeviceTokenFormatException.java10
A
0 mins
src/main/java/javapns/devices/exceptions/NullDeviceTokenException.java14
A
0 mins
src/main/java/javapns/devices/exceptions/NullIdException.java14
A
45 mins
src/main/java/javapns/devices/exceptions/UnknownDeviceException.java14
A
45 mins
src/main/java/javapns/devices/exceptions/package.html
src/main/java/javapns/devices/implementations/basic/BasicDevice.java62
A
0 mins
src/main/java/javapns/devices/implementations/basic/BasicDeviceFactory.java55
A
1 hr
src/main/java/javapns/devices/implementations/basic/package.html
src/main/java/javapns/devices/implementations/jpa/README.md
src/main/java/javapns/devices/implementations/jpa/injection.xml
src/main/java/javapns/devices/implementations/jpa/package.html
src/main/java/javapns/devices/implementations/package.html
src/main/java/javapns/devices/package.html
src/main/java/javapns/feedback/AppleFeedbackServer.java10
A
0 mins
src/main/java/javapns/feedback/AppleFeedbackServerBasicImpl.java25
A
1 hr
src/main/java/javapns/feedback/ConnectionToFeedbackServer.java21
A
40 mins
src/main/java/javapns/feedback/FeedbackServiceManager.java95
A
2 hrs
src/main/java/javapns/feedback/package.html
src/main/java/javapns/notification/AppleNotificationServer.java10
A
0 mins
src/main/java/javapns/notification/AppleNotificationServerBasicImpl.java25
A
1 hr
src/main/java/javapns/notification/ConnectionToNotificationServer.java20
A
40 mins
src/main/java/javapns/notification/NewsstandNotificationPayload.java37
A
0 mins
src/main/java/javapns/notification/Payload.java172
B
6 hrs